| Abstract;In 1997 three different kinds of .SIGMA. factor genes were cloned from Arabidopsis thaliana. Two different nuclear genes encoding bacteriophage type RNA polymerase or nuclear-encoded plastid RNA plymerase(NEP) which is seemed to function by targeting respective chloroplast or mitochondrion, were also cloned. These knowledges have clarified fundamental transcriptional device of plastid genes. Taking this chance, interesting sides of the regulatory mechanisms of plastid gene expression has been elucidated. Here the knowledges focused on recently clarified transcriptional mechanisms of photosynthetic plastid genes such as rbcL, psbA, and atpB/E genes are explained. |
